I’m having a problem with steam since about 2 weeks and I’m really pissed. Everytime I want to play Counter-Strike : Source, it says “This game is currently unavailable. Please try again later.”. I already had this problem with some games, but I just had to delete the ClientRegistry.blob in the steam folder to make it work again, but this time it doesn’t work. I’m having this problem only with Counter-Strike : Source, every other game works fine. If you know how to fix this out…

you could try to:

a.) verify game cache
or
b.) reinstall Css again
or
c.) reinstall Steam with Css again

Right click CSS on your desktop, click “Open File Location”

Go to steamapps>YOURNAME> Counter Strike Source

Delete the folder called “Cstrike”.

This should cause Steam to reload you a fresh copy of CSS the next time you try to launch it. If this doesn’t work, play something else.
